Eligibility Criteria
Check the participation requirements, including inclusion and exclusion rules, age limits, and whether healthy volunteers are accepted.
Inclusion Criteria
1. Children categorized as class I or II according to American Society of Anaesthesiologists (ASA) scale.
2. Children rated as no. 3 or 4 in Frankl behaviour rating scale (FBRS).
3. Presence of a small carious or traumatic pulp exposure (1 mm or less). 2. Radiographic:
<!-- -->
1. Presence of at least two-thirds of root length.
2. Normal lamina dura and periodontal ligament space.
Exclusion Criteria
1. History of spontaneous unprovoked toothache.
2. Extensive crown destruction that preclude coronal restoration.
3. Gingival swelling, sinus tract or other soft tissue pathology.
4. Abnormal tooth mobility.
5. A frank pulp exposure (i.e., greater than 1.0mm), requiring pulpotomy.
6. No evidence of visible pulp exposure.
2\. Radiographic:
<!-- -->
1. Furcation/periapical radiolucency.
2. Pathological internal/external root resorption.
3. Absence of underlying permanent successor
